Tools Needed
2 small flat head screwdrivers to manipulate the Honda plastic fairing clips. They are self-locking and a nightmare to deal with. Use one of the screwdrivers to press down on the center of the head of the screw. Use the other screwdriver to press up on the edge. The plastic should release. BE CAREFUL not to be too harsh with these clips as they are made of plastic and not meant to last. It's a good idea to have a few spares of these around, but be aware that there are SEVERAL different types of Honda clips.
